The Ultimate Guide to Choosing the Best Car Wash Soap
Keeping your car clean is more than just about looks. A good soap protects your paint and keeps your vehicle shining like new. Many people make the mistake of using dish soap, which can actually strip away protective wax. This guide helps you pick the right soap for your ride.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for car soap, look for these three main features:
- pH Balance: A pH-neutral formula is safe for your paint. It cleans dirt without damaging the clear coat.
- Lubricity: Good soap feels slippery. This slickness helps the wash mitt glide over the surface, which prevents scratches.
- Foam Production: Thick suds lift dirt away from the paint. This allows you to rinse the grime off easily.
Important Materials and Ingredients
Most high-quality car soaps use surfactants. These are ingredients that break down oil and dirt. Some soaps also include polymers. These chemicals add a thin layer of shine to the paint. Avoid soaps that contain harsh chemicals like bleach or ammonia, as these will ruin your car’s finish over time.
Factors That Affect Quality
The quality of your soap depends on how it handles dirt. A high-quality soap will suspend dirt particles in the water. This keeps the grit from rubbing against your car while you wash. Low-quality soaps often leave water spots or a hazy film behind. If a soap dries too fast, it can leave streaks, so always look for formulas that rinse clean.
User Experience and Use Cases
Your experience depends on how you wash your car. If you use a foam cannon, you need a high-foaming soap. If you prefer the two-bucket method, a standard concentrated soap works best. Some soaps are “wash and wax” combos. These are great for people who want to save time. However, if you plan to apply a separate ceramic coating or sealant, use a plain soap instead.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I use dish soap to wash my car?
A: No. Dish soap is designed to strip grease from plates. It will also strip the wax off your car and dry out rubber seals.
Q: What is a pH-neutral soap?
A: It is a soap that is not acidic or alkaline. It is the safest choice for all car paints and finishes.
Q: Do I need a foam cannon?
A: You do not need one. It makes washing fun and helps cover the car in suds, but a bucket and sponge work just fine.
Q: How much soap should I use?
A: Follow the directions on the bottle. Using too much soap makes it hard to rinse, while too little won’t provide enough lubrication.
Q: Will car soap remove bird droppings?
A: Yes, but you should soak the area first. Let the suds sit for a minute to soften the mess before you wipe it away.
Q: Are “wash and wax” soaps worth it?
A: They are great for quick maintenance. They add a nice shine, but they do not replace a real layer of car wax.
Q: Should I wash my car in direct sunlight?
A: Try to avoid this. Sunlight dries the soap too fast, which leads to water spots and streaks.
Q: Does the color of the soap matter?
A: No. The color is usually just for looks or scent. Focus on the ingredients instead.
Q: How often should I wash my car?
A: Once every two weeks is a good rule. This prevents dirt and road salt from building up.
Q: Is expensive soap always better?
A: Not always. Many mid-priced soaps perform just as well as premium brands. Read reviews to find the best value.
